Sacrifice Wiki is a collaborative website about the game Sacrifice developed by Shiny Entertainment.
Sacrifice is a real-time strategy game that can be operated by Windows 98 and Mac OS 9.2 users. Players control wizards that are able to conjure spells and amass armies using magical energy known as mana. The objective of the game is to desecrate the enemy's altar.
The campaign of Sacrifice follows the story of a vagrant wizard known as Eldred. Once the tyrant ruler of Jhera, he wanders the ethereal realm in search of a home. Five Gods (Persephone, James, Stratos, Pyro and Charnel ) offer him solace, but Eldred must settle with one.
Soon, a war ensues after the Gods hear of a prophecy that foretells the emergence of a powerful and evil wizard named Marduk - a creature that Eldred helped create. Determined to rectify his wrongdoings, Eldred seeks out Marduk with the intent to destroy him. Meanwhile, the Gods' once harmless bickering transforms into all-out warfare.
